WebApr 30, 2024 · Catabolic sequelae of cancer chemotherapy add substantially to overall weight loss and muscle catabolism. Common side effects of cytotoxic chemotherapy include anorexia, nausea and vomiting, which are nutritionally impactful symptoms that contribute to reduced food intake and hence to weight loss.
